Technical Parameters:
Machine Name | Microwave drying machine |
Total Power Input | 180kW |
Model | HD-120CD |
Microwave Output Power | 120kW Tunnel structure, Power can be adjusted |
Microwave Frequency | 2450MHz±50MHz |
Dimensions | 18500×1450×1800㎜ |
Height of Feeding | 60mm |
Width of Conveyer Belt | 1200mm |
Conveyor Speed | 0.5~10 m/min |
Operating Temperature | -5~40℃ |
Surrounding | Without corrosive gas, conductive dust and gas explosion |
Wooden Cases | Export standard fumigation wooden cases |
Description:
Microwave drying originated in the 1940s. By the end of the 1960s, microwaves could be used in heating, drying, insecticidal, sterilization and other fields. Due to the unique advantages of microwave, it has developed rapidly. Microwave technology and its application as a high-tech have been designated as the key research and development projects of China's "10th Five-Year Plan".

What is penetration? Penetration ability is the ability of electromagnetic waves to penetrate into the medium. When electromagnetic waves enter the medium from the surface and propagate inside, the energy is continuously absorbed and can be converted into heat.
Applicable for
Processing of light industrial products such as food, tea, tobacco, leather, medicine, paper, wood, rubber, etc., as well as grain drying and seed treatment in agriculture.
1 | Anti-mildew sterilization: Microwave heating has thermal and biological effects, so it can kill mold and sterilize at lower temperatures; it can better preserve the activity of materials and vitamins, color and nutrients in food. |
2 | no dust pollution, easy to clean, what GMP requirements. |
3 | easy to control, flexible and convenient to operate, microwave power and transmission speed are adjustable. Programmable automation of the heating process with the HMI and PLC. |
4 | energy-saving and high-efficiency, because there is moisture content that easily absorbs microwaves and generates heat, so the transmission loss is low, and there is almost no other loss, so the heat effect is high and energy is saved. It saves more than 1/3 of energy by infrared heating. |
